### Changed: `SCANNER_KEY` renamed to `WANDLINE_SCANNER_TOKEN`

As of v2.4.0, the Wandline barcode scanner integration no longer reads the legacy `SCANNER_KEY` variable. This rename avoids a collision with the warehouse printer module introduced in v2.3. If you are setting up a fresh environment, do not carry the old name forward — the integration will silently fall back to unauthenticated mode and fail at dock check-in. Instead, add this line to your .env:

sealed setting: LEDGER_TOKEN13=5d842615a26d7

## Runbook: Sensor drift in the Verdantia greenhouse controller

When humidity or temperature readings from a Verdantia zone diverge more than 5% from the reference probe for over 15 minutes, the controller flags the sensor as drifting and switches that zone to conservative ventilation. Before replacing hardware, confirm the drift threshold and smoothing window have not been altered by a site operator — most escalations turn out to be local overrides. Compare the unit's live settings against the expected configuration shown here.

service settings:
PRAIX_LOG_LEVEL=error
PRAIX_METRICS_HOST=metrics.praix.qorvelcorp.corp
PRAIX_POOL_SIZE=16

During the severe-storm burst, the fan-out worker retried failed pushes without jitter, amplifying load on the notification gateway and delaying alerts by up to eleven minutes. The fix introduces bounded exponential backoff with jitter, a per-region concurrency ceiling, and a circuit breaker on gateway errors. Reviewer: please verify each constant against the load-test report attached to the ticket, since these values were derived empirically. The tuned constants are as follows.

constants for kageg-bawif:
QUOTAS = {
    "quenwyn": 1,
    "oliix": 10,
}

## v2.8.1 — Donation-Receipt Mailer

- Fixed duplicate receipts sent when a donor retried a failed card on Givewell-style recurring plans in Plumeria.
- Receipt totals now include processing-fee offsets.
- PDF attachment renamed to include donation date.
- Retry queue drains every 10 min instead of hourly.

Support: duplicates sent before this release cannot be recalled; advise donors to keep the latest copy. Escalations for receipt issues go to the owner listed below.

named custodian: Brivan Eliath Quenox Frador